Induction and Inhibition of a Neuronal Phenotype in Spodoptera Frugiperda (Sf21) Insect Cells

Jenson, Lacey Jo 15 April 2010 (has links)
Due to the increasing resistance demonstrated by insects to conventional insecticides, the need for compounds with novel modes of action is becoming more urgent. Also, the discovery and production of new insecticides is vital as regulations and restrictions on conventional insecticides become increasingly stringent (Casida and Quistad 1998). Research in this area requires screening of many candidate compounds which is costly and time-consuming. The goal of this research was to produce in vitro insect neurons from Sf21 insect ovarian cell lines, which could lead to new high throughput screening methods and a way to mass produce insect material for basic research. This study used a culture of Sf21 cells and a mixture of differentiation agents to produce viable neuron-like cells. In the presence of the molting hormone 20-hydroxyecdysone (20-HE), or insulin, in the growth medium, Sf21 cells began to express neuronal morphology, or the production of elongated, axon-like processes within 2-3 days. Maximal differentiation occurred when in the presence of 42 μM 20-HE or 10 μM insulin. Effects were maximal on day 2 for 20-E and day 3 for insulin. Insulin was more potent at day 2 for inducing differentiation (EC₅₀ = 247 nM) than 20-HE (EC₅₀ = 13 μM). In combination, 20-HE and insulin produced apparent synergistic effects on differentiation. Caffeine, a central nervous system (CNS) stimulant, inhibited induction of elongated processes by 20-HE and/or insulin. Caffeine was a potent inhibitor of 42 μM 20-HE, with an IC50 of 9 nM, and the inhibition was incomplete, resulting in about one quarter of the differentiated cells remaining, even at high concentrations (up to 1 mM). The ability to induce a neural phenotype simplifies studies with of insect cells, compared to either the use of primary nervous tissue or genetic engineering techniques. The presence of ion channels or receptors in the differentiated cells remains to be determined. If they are present, high throughput screening for new insecticides will be accelerated and made more economical by the utility of this method. / Master of Science

Stomoxys calcitrans (L. 1758) : morphologie, biologie, rôle vecteur et moyens de lutte / Stomoxys calcitrans (L. 1758) : morphology, biology, vector role and control methods

Salem, Ali 14 November 2012 (has links)
La mouche charbonneuse, Stomoxys calcitrans (L.) est une des espèces les plus nuisibles en élevage. Elle est responsable de pertes directes et indirectes : piqûres douloureuses, spoliation sanguine et transmission d'agents pathogènes. Afin de mieux étudier ce parasite, nous avons mis en place un élevage dans notre laboratoire comprenant deux souches issues de stomoxes sauvages capturés respectivement à l'ENVT et dans un élevage bovin biologique. Le protocole d'élevage est décrit. Nous avons comparé les caractères morphologiques externes des différents stades évolutifs obtenus à partir de notre élevage aux données bibliographiques. Nous avons montré les capacités de transmission mécanique par S. calcitrans de Besnoitia besnoiti, agent de la besnoitiose bovine. Nous avons mis en évidence également des différences de sensibilité entre les deux souches à six insecticides dues probablement à une exposition plus grande à ces derniers de la souche ENVT / Stable fly, Stomoxys calcitrans (L.) is one of the most commonly pest of livestock with direct and indirect sides effects: painful bites, blood loss and transmission of pathogens. To better study this parasite, we have established two strains in our laboratory isolated from two geographical origins: the National Veterinary School of Toulouse and an organic cattle farm. We described the rearing protocol in the laboratory. We compared the external morphological characters of the different developmental instars observed in our rearing to data literature. We have demonstrated the ability of S. calcitrans to mechanically transmit Besnoitia besnoiti, responsible of the cattle besnoitiosis. We have also highlighted differences in susceptibility between the two strains to six insecticides probably due to records of higher exposure to them for the ENVT strain

Effet de faibles doses d'un insecticide néonicotinoïde sur le système olfactif d'un lépidoptère de ravageur des cultures, Agrotis ipsilon / Neonicotinoid insecticide low doses effects on the olfactory system of the lepidopteran crop pest, Agrotis ipsilon

Rabhi, Kaouther 06 November 2015 (has links)
Durant leur cycle de vie, les insectes doivent faire face à différents perturbateurs pour réussir à survivre et à se reproduire. L’utilisation de plus en plus répandue des insecticides néonicotinoïdes, en raison de leur grande efficacité, a conduit à l’accumulation de résidus dans l’environnement. Ceux-ci ont certainement un effet additif toxique sur les insectes cibles. Cependant il a été montré que ces résidus peuvent aussi avoir un effet positif non désiré sur certains traits de vie des insectes ravageurs.Dans ma thèse, j’ai étudié les effets d’un insecticide néonicotinoïde sur le système olfactif d’un insecte ravageur, la noctuelle Agrotis ipsilon. Nos résultats montrent que l’exposition aigüe des mâles à des faibles doses de clothianidine modifie leurs réponses comportementales à la phéromone sexuelle: une baisse est observée à la dose 0,25 ng/insecte (<DL0) alors que la doses de 10 ng (DL20) induit une augmentation de la réponse chez les adultes naïfs ou pré-exposés à la phéromone. Cet effet biphasique à faible et très faible dose s’apparente à un effet hormétique et les modifications observées sont corrélées avec des changements de sensibilité du système olfactif central et non périphérique. Nous émettons l’hypothèse que la clothianidine agirait sur l’expression des sous-unités des récepteurs nicotiniques pour lesquels elle joue le rôle d’agoniste, changeant leur affinité pour l’acétylcholine et perturbant ou améliorant la transmission synaptique des signaux sensoriels selon la dose. Nos résultats montrent que la prise en compte d’effets de doses sublétales d’insecticides est essentielle non seulement pour les insectes non cibles, mais aussi des insectes cibles. / Insects face a multitude of environmental stresses, which they have to bypass in order to survive and reproduce. The extensive use of neonicotinoid insecticides, because of their high efficiency, leads to the accumulation of residues in the environment, which can have an additive toxic effect on target insects. However, such residues can also have unwanted positive effects on certain life traits of pest insects. In my thesis I studied the effects of a neonicotinoid insecticide on the olfactory system of the pest insect Agrotis ipsilon. Our results show that acute oral treatments of males with low doses of clothianidin modify their behavioural responses to the sex pheromone: a treatment with 0.25 ng/moth (<LD0) induces a decrease of pheromone responses whereas intoxication with 10 ng/moth (LD20) leads to an increase in the capacity of naive and pre-exposed males to locate a pheromone source as compared to controls. We propose that this biphasic effect, with low dose stimulation and very low dose inhibition is an hormeticlike effect, that is correlated with sensitivity changes within the central, but not the peripheral olfactory system. We hypothesize that the observed modifications might be due to a differential effect of clothianidin on the expression of different subunits of nicotinic acetylcholine receptors, which might change the affinity of the receptors for acetylcholine, and thus disturb or improve synaptic transmission of sensory signals as a function of the insecticide dose. Our results show that effects of sublethal doses of insecticides need to be taken into account not only for non-target, but also for target insects when evaluating pest management strategies.

Suivi temportel des niveaux de concentration en atmosphère intérieure lors de l'application d'insecticides ménagers

Vesin, Aude 18 April 2013 (has links)
L'étude du comportement dynamique des substances actives pendant l'épandage de produits insecticides ménagers commerciaux dans les atmosphères intérieures nécessite le développement et l'adaptation de procédures analytiques de mesure en ligne ayant une résolution temporelle élevée. Un HS-PTR-MS et un HR-ToF-AMS ont par conséquent été utilisés pour mesurer les contaminants à la fois en phase gazeuse et particulaire. Les substances actives ciblées par cette étude appartiennent à la famille des pyréthrinoïdes, présentes dans différentes formulations commerciales du type diffuseurs électriques et sprays aérosols, qui ont été appliqués dans une pièce d'étude simulant une atmosphère réelle dans la maison expérimentale MARIA du Centre Scientifique et Technique du Bâtiment. Les résultats de ces mesures montrent des pics de concentration compris entre 1,5 et 8,5 µg.m-3, après 8 heures de branchement des diffuseurs électriques. Les pics de concentration des substances actives après l'application des sprays peuvent atteindre plusieurs dizaines de µg.m-3. La ventilation et la sédimentation des aérosols apparaissent comme des mécanismes majeurs d'élimination des polluants du compartiment air. Par ailleurs, une distribution importante des substances actives avec les surfaces de la pièce (murs, sol, plafond, particules en suspension et poussières) est observée. L'évaluation de l'exposition par inhalation aux produits insecticides étudiés montre qu'il n'existe a priori pas de risque pour la santé. Néanmoins, une évaluation intégrée, prenant en compte toutes les voies d'exposition est nécessaire avant de conclure à une absence de risque sanitaire. / The study of the dynamic behaviour of the active substances during the application of commercial household insecticide products in indoor atmospheres requires the development of the adaptation of on-line analytical procedures with high time resolution. A HS-PTR-MS and a HR-ToF-AMS have therefore been used to measure contaminants both in the gaseous and particulate phase. The active substances targeted by this study belong to the pyrethroids, which are present in different commercial formulations like electric vaporizers and sprays that were applied in a full-scale test room simulating a real atmosphere in the experimental house MARIA of the French scientific and technical centre for building. The results of these measurements show that peak concentrations during a 8h-emission of electric vaporizers range from 1,5 et 8,5 µg.m-3. The peak concentrations of active substances during spraying can reach several dozens of µg.m-3. Ventilation and deposition of aerosols are major elimination mechanisms of pollutants from the air compartment. Moreover, an important distribution of active substances with the surfaces of the room (walls, floor, ceiling, suspended particles and dust) is observed. The evaluation of inhalation exposure to the studied insecticide products show that adverse effects are not likely to occur. Nevertheless, to conclude that these products are safe, it is necessary to perform an integrated evaluation, taking into account all exposure routes.

Rôle de Ctenocephalides felis (bouché, 1835) [Siphonaptera Pulicidae] dans la transmission de Bartonella spp. [Rhizobiales Bartonellaceae] et moyens de contrôle / Role of Ctenocephalides felis (Bouché, 1835) [Siphonaptera Pulicidae] in the transmission of Bartonella spp. and control

Bouhsira, Emilie 25 April 2014 (has links)
Ctenocephalides felis est une espèce de puce cosmopolite parasitant majoritairement les carnivores domestiques. Elle est vectrice de nombreux agents pathogènes zoonotiques dont les bactéries du genre Bartonella, bactéries intracellulaires facultatives. La compétence vectorielle de cette puce a été investiguée pour B. henselae, B. quintana, B. clarridgeiae, B. tribocorum et B. birtlesii. Dans ces conditions expérimentales, utilisant un système de gorgement sur membrane, ces espèces ont persisté pendant les trois jours d'une première étude, et pour B. henselae durant les 13 jours de survie des puces, dans une seconde étude. Les cinq espèces de bartonelles ont été retouvées dans les fèces. Pour ces cinq espèces, nos résultats montrent une absence de transmission verticale transovarienne chez la puce et suggèrent une possibilité de contamination horizontale. Nous proposons enfin un protocole original d'évaluation de l'efficacité d'un traitement antiparasitaire chez le chat, pour prévenir sa contamination par Bartonella spp. / Ctenocephalides felis is a cosmopolitan flea species mainly parasitizing pets, transmitting several pathogens of veterinary and zoonotic importance including the facultative intracellular bacteria of the genus Bartonella. The vector competence of this flea was investigated for B. henselae, B. quintana, B. clarridgeiae, B. tribocorum and B. birtlesii, using an artificial feeding system. In these experimental conditions, these bartonellae proved to persist for three days, in a first study, while B. henselae persisted for the 13 days of its life span, in a second study. All five bartonellae were excreted in the flea's faeces. On the whole, these five species were not transmitted transovarially in the fleas, though horizontal transmission was suggested. Furthermore, we propose an original protocol allowing the evaluation of the efficacy of ectoparasiticidal products against Bartonella spp. infection in cats.

Distribuição do endosulfan em alguns elementos do ecossistema após aplicação na cultura do algodão / Distribution of endosulfan in some ecosystem elements after application in crop of cotton

Bertochi, Helena Romilda 10 February 2006 (has links)
Este estudo foi realizado na safra 2002/2003 quando foi avaliado os níveis de endosulfan e seus principais produtos de transformação numa área agrícola localizada na cabeceira de uma microbacia do município de Aguaí-SP. Os objetivos específicos foram: (i) avaliar a movimentação do endosulfan e seus principais transformação no solo sob a cultura do algodão (áreas submetidas à aplicação), (ii) avaliar sua transferência de compartimento (transporte para o solo sob milho e braquiária, adjacentes às áreas aplicadas, e para os corpos aquosos - nascente, lago, córrego jusante e poço), (iii) avaliar os resíduos de endosulfan e seus produtos de transformação nos peixes do açude e (iv) predizer, através de modelagem matemática, a concentração de endosulfan passível de atingir o corpo d\'água e a largura mínima da faixa de contenção (mata ciliar) para impedir a chegada dos produtos no lago. Para tanto, foram realizadas amostragens de solo, sedimento, água dos corpos hídricos e da enxurrada e de peixes, durante sete meses, nas quais foram realizadas análises de &#945;- e &#946;-endosulfan, endosulfan sulfato e endosulfan diol. As análises foram efetuadas por cromatografia gasosa com detecção por espectrometria de massa. Para prever a concentração do produto passível de atingir o açude, tanto associada ao sedimento como na forma livre, foi realizada uma modelagem matemática com base nas propriedades físico-químicas do produto e nas condições edafoclimáticas e de manejo da área estudada. Pôde-se concluir que: (i) o endosulfan e seu produto de transformação endosulfan sulfato não apresentam potencial de lixiviação no solo nas condições estudadas; (ii) a persistência do endosulfan no campo é menor em relação aos estudos de laboratório, sendo que o isômero alfa é o que apresenta a mais rápida degradação e o principal produto de transformação do endosulfan no solo é o endosulfan sulfato; (iii) a principal via de transporte do endosulfan e do endosulfan sulfato no ambiente é o escoamento superficial; (iv) o endosulfan e seus produtos de transformação são transportados associados as micropartículas de solo (\"resíduo-ligado\"); (v) quando a aplicação segue as recomendações estabelecidas pelo fabricante, o produto somente apresenta potencial para atingir áreas adjacentes se houver caminhamento da enxurrada para estas áreas; (vii) o endosulfan e seus produtos de degradação, em sua fase de \"resíduo-ligado\", não apresentam efeito agudo e bioacumulação para as espécies de lambari (Astyanax sp.) e tilápia (Oreochroms sp.) da área nas concentrações observadas neste estudo e (viii) pela modelagem matemática, dentro das condições estudadas, 40 metros de faixa de contenção seria suficiente para impedir a chegada do endosulfan e do endosulfan sulfato nos corpos d\'água, desde que não houvesse fluxo preferencial de enxurrada. / The study was carried out during 2002/2003, and its objective was to evaluate the levels of endosulfan and its main transformation products in a fanning area located at the head of a small valley close to the town of Águaí, SP, Brazil. The specific objectives were: (i) to evaluate the dynamics of endosulfan and its main transformation products in the soil beneath a crop of cotton (areas treated with endosulfan), (ii) to evaluate the transfer of endosulfan among various locations [transport from the applied areas into the adjacent areas cultivated with maize (Zea mays) and brachiaria (Brachiaria spp.), and into various bodies of water - a spring, a lake (pond), a small flowing stream and a well], (iii) to evaluate the presence of the residues of endosulfan and its transformation products on fish in the lake and (iv) to predict, using mathematical modeling, the endosulfan concentration able to reach the lake and the minimum width buffer zone (containment strip or riparian vegetation) needed to avoid the arrival of the pesticide in the lake. In order to achieve this, representative samples of the following types were collected - soil, sediment, fish, water from the spring, the pond, the stream and the well, as well as from the runoff. Samples were collected during a period of seven months, and were analyzed for &#945;- and &#946;-endosulfan, endosulfan sulfate and endosulfan diol. The analyses were performed by gas chromatography, with mass spectrometric detection. Mathematical approach was employed to predict the concentration of endosulfan that could reach the lake, and in which form it would be present (free or sorbed to soil microparticles). Input data for the model were the physical-chemical properties of endosulfan, the local soil and climatic conditions, and the management of the study area. It was possible to conclude that: (i) endosulfan and its transformation products endosulfan sulfate do not present potential leaching in the soil profile; (ii) the persistence of endosulfan in the field is shorter than has been found in laboratory studies, &#945;-endosulfan is degrades more rapidly than &#946;-endosulfan and endosulfan sulfate is the main transformation product; (iii) runoff is the principal transport mechanism for endosulfan and endosulfan sulfate in the environment; (iv) the transformation products are transported by attachment to microparticles of soil (\"bound residues\"); (v) when the application of endosulfan follows the recommendations of the manufacturer, the compound is only likely to reach adjacent areas if there is a runoff into these areas; (vii) the products, in the \"bound residue\" form, do not produce acute effects and bioaccumulation in the species of fish lambari (Astyanax sp.) and tilapia (Oreochroms sp.) from the area, and (viii) the modeling has established that, within the conditions of the study, a 40 m wide containment strip is sufficient to prevent the appearance of endosulfan and endosulfan sulfate in bodies of water, considering that there is no prefential flow of runoff water.

Utilisation des huiles essentielles pour la protection des grains contre les insectes ravageurs au Nord Cameroun

Noudjou Wandi, Félicité 11 December 2007 (has links)
Les paysans stockent entre 60 et 80% de la production des grains qui est régulièrement infestée par les insectes ravageurs. Les plantes insecticides méritent dêtre valorisées à travers notamment leur huile essentielle afin de limiter la dépendance des paysans aux insecticides chimiques, largement utilisés au Nord du Cameroun et dont les dangers sont bien connus. Lanalyse chromatographique de quelques huiles essentielles locales, révèle que Cymbopogon citratus (DC.) Stapf. (Poacée), Ocimum gratissimum L. (Lamiacée) et Ocimum suave Willd (Lamiacée) sont constituées respectivement du citral, du thymol et de leugénol à plus de 50%. Les huiles essentielles de Annona senegalensis Pers. (Annonacée), Hyptis spicigera Lam. (Lamiacée), et Xylopia aethiopica (Dunal) A. Rich. (Annonacée), contiennent majoritairement des monoterpènes hydrocarbonés dont lα-phellandrène, lα-pinène, le sabinène et le β-pinène. H. spicigera et X. aethiopica, dont la composition varie suivant lorigine de la plante, sont les plus efficaces contre Callosobruchus maculatus (F.) et Sitophilus zeamais (Motsch.), principaux ravageurs primaires des greniers au Nord du Cameroun. Lactivité insecticide de H. spicigera est marquée par sa teneur en α-pinène (39,0%) tandis que celle de X. aethiopica est due à leffet synergique de ses composés. La volatilité des huiles essentielles nécessite des supports aptes à réguler le relarguage des molécules volatiles. Avec plus de 90% de molécules volatiles libérées en 7 jours, la poudre des infrutescences de X. aethiopica, qui contiennent plus de 5% dhuile essentielle, bien que toxique contre C. maculatus, ne permet pas de réguler et de prolonger la libération des molécules volatiles. Le kaolin testé dégrade lhuile essentielle X. aethiopica tandis que lincorporation de lamidon à la gomme arabique permet de libérer en 7 jours, 40,5 à 55,9% des molécules volatiles suivant la proportion damidon. Cette combinaison est un système qui autorégule le relarguage en deux phases. La première phase a un taux de relarguage élevé qui entraîne un effet « Knock down » sur C. maculatus, et la seconde phase présente un relarguage lent et prolongé qui pourrait, par un effet répulsif, éviter linfestation des grains stockés. Cette étude est une contribution du projet « STOREPROTECT PIC-2003 » à la protection des denrées stockées par lutilisation des ressources locales au Nord du Cameroun.

Resistência a inseticidas e falhas no controle de Tuta absoluta / Insecticides resistance and failure control the Tuta absoluta

Silva, Gerson Adriano 17 February 2009 (has links)

No. of bitstreams: 1 texto completo.pdf: 308576 bytes, checksum: 4517ced7e005a18483bc835f89df8a70 (MD5) Previous issue date: 2009-02-17 / Conselho Nacional de Desenvolvimento Científico e Tecnológico / The Tuta absoluta (Meyrick) (Lepidoptera: Gelechiidae) is the most important pest of tomato Lycopersicon esculentum Mill in Brazil. Their larvae consume the leaf mesophyll, attack stems, flowers and fruits of tomato, reducing the productivity of this culture and consequently the profitability of farmers. For reducing this insect attack, farmers use insecticides intensively, and often the efficacy control is not reached as desired. One possible reason for the low efficiency is the resistance development to insecticides in populations of this insect. Therefore, tomato producers need search for detecting and monitoring of the T. absolute populations resistance to insecticides. The objective of this study was identified resistance to insecticides in T. absoluta populations from major regions tomato producing of Brazil, and verified the control failures of this pest. The populations were from Cerrado, Southeast and Northeast of Brazil. Ten insecticides were used, six neurotoxic, three insects growth regulators and one which has the bacterium Bacillus thuringiensis as active ingredient. In populations from Cerrado and Southeast the abamectin, spinosad, deltamethrin, triazophos, indoxacarb and bifenthrin were in ascending order, the insecticides that showed the lowest level of resistance among the products tested. In Northeast s population the same resistance was observed, except for bifenthrin, which was replaced by teflubenzurom. The insecticides diflubenzurom, permethrin, triflumurom and the B. Thuringiensis had larger numbers of resistant populations to insecticides in all regions. The T. absoluta population from Viçosa-MG is the most appropriate to be used as susceptibility pattern in resistance study to insecticides of this pest. In recommended doses by industries, the abamectin, spinosad, deltamethrin and triazophos insecticides had not control failures of the T. absolute populations, while the bifenthrin has control failures of populations from Uberlândia, Paulínea and Camocim de São Felix, the indoxacarb had control failures of populations from Uberlândia, São João da Barra and Viçosa, teflubenzurom had control failures of populations from Goianápolis, São João da Barra, Viçosa and Santa Tereza, diflubenzurom, permethrin, triflumurom and B. thuringiensis had control failures in all the T absolute populations which were tested. The correct management of this pest, through the practices which contribute for increasing of control efficacy, can help prevent, delay or reverse the resistance development of this insect pest to insecticides. / A Tuta absoluta (Meyrick) (Lepidoptera: Gelechiidae) é a praga mais importante do tomateiro Lycopersicon esculentum Mill no Brasil. As larvas desse inseto-praga consomem o mesófilo foliar, bloqueiam os ponteiros, os botões florais, as flores e frutos do tomateiro, reduzindo a produtividade dessa cultura, comprometendo a lucratividade dos tomaticultores. Com o intuito de minimizar o efeito desse inseto, os agricultores fazem o uso intensivo de inseticidas, que muitas vezes não alcançam a eficiência de controle desejada. Uma das possíveis razões para a baixa eficiência esta o desenvolvimento da resistência a inseticida em populações desse inseto. Dessa forma, a tomaticultura carece de trabalhos que visem à detecção e o monitoramento adequado de populações de T. absoluta resistentes a inseticidas. Assim, o objetivo desse trabalho estudar e identificar a ocorrência de resistência em populações de T. absoluta a inseticidas nas principais regiões produtoras de tomate do Brasil, e verificar falhas no controle desta praga. As populações foram provenientes do Cerrado, Sudeste e Nordeste. Foram utilizados dez inseticidas, sendo seis neurotóxicos, três reguladores de crescimento e um que tem como ingrediente ativo a bactéria Bacillus thuringiensis. Para as macrorregiões do Cerrado e Sudeste, abamectina, espinosade, deltametrina mais triazofós, indoxacarbe e bifentrina foram, em ordem crescente, os inseticidas que apresentaram o menor nível de resistência dentre os produtos testados. Para o Nordeste observou-se o mesmo padrão, com exceção da bifentrina que foi substituída pelo teflubenzurom. Os inseticidas diflubenzurom, permetrina, o triflumurom e o B. thuringiensis apresentaram números maiores de populações resistentes a inseticidas em todas as macrorregiões. A população de Tuta absoluta de Viçosa-MG é a mais adequada a ser utilizada como padrão de suscetibilidade em estudos de resistência a inseticidas. Nas doses recomendadas pelos fabricantes, os inseticidas abamectina, espinosade, deltametrina mais triazofós não apresentaram falhas no controle das populações de T. absoluta, já a bifentrina apresentou falhas no controle das populações de Uberlândia, Paulínea e Camocim de São Felix, o indoxacarbe apresentou falhas no controle das populações de Uberlândia, São João da Barra e Viçosa, o teflubenzurom apresentou falhas no controle das populações de Goianápolis, São João da Barra, Viçosa e Santa Tereza, o diflubenzurom, permetrina, triflumurom e o a base de B. thuringiensis apresentaram falhas no controle de todas as populações de T absoluta testadas. O manejo correto dessa praga através de práticas que contribuam para um controle mais eficiente pode ajuda a prevenir, retardar ou reverter à evolução da resistência deste inseto-praga a inseticidas.
